Build

Tutorials, demos, and code walkthroughs for a wide variety of real-time web, mobile, and IoT projects.

BuildJul 28, 2019

Add Geocoding, Mapping with Mapbox & PubNub BLOCKS

Enable real-time geocoding and mapping in an AngularJS web application with a modest 44-line PubNub JavaScript BLOCK and 73 lines of HTML/JS.
Michael Carroll
Michael Carroll
BuildJul 28, 2019

Add Turn-by-Turn Navigation with Mapbox Directions API

Mapbox Directions API provides a variety of navigation features for driving, cycling and walking, including turn-by-turn directions, traffic-aware routing, and ETA calculation. And with Mapbox, all your functionality is overlayed on one of their many beautiful vector maps. In this tutorial, we’ll...
Michael Carroll
Michael Carroll
BuildJul 28, 2019

Embed a Static Map and Update Geolocation with Mapbox

Mapbox is a flexible platform that provides a ton of awesome mapping and geolocation APIs. At PubNub, we love Mapbox because you can now build beautiful and interactive geolocation and tracking apps by integrating real-time functionality. With that, we’ve launched a number of Mapbox BLOCKS in our...
Michael Carroll
Michael Carroll
BuildJul 28, 2019

Multiplayer Gaming Basics Using Phaser – Occupancy Counter

How to build a JavaScript occupancy counter for multiplayer games that automatically updates a counter based on new users going online or offline.

Michael Carroll
Michael Carroll
Real-time Visualizations and Dashboards with Epoch
BuildJul 28, 2019

Real-time Visualizations & Dashboards with Epoch and Python

There are a ton of dashboard and visualization tools out there – D3.js, EON and others, some of which you can find tutorials on right here at PubNub’s blog. In this tutorial, we’ll look at another option, Epoch, a general purpose real-time charting library for building beautiful, smooth,...
Michael Carroll
Michael Carroll
BuildJul 28, 2019

Real-time User and Device Detection with Presence

How to use Presence for real-time user and device detection.

Michael Carroll
Michael Carroll
BuildJul 25, 2019

Real-time Machine Learning: Online Learning with PubNub

Exploring one of the most popular machine learning algorithms in real time data streaming, online learning, including theory and building a machine learning model.

Cameron Akhavan
Cameron Akhavan
Developer Relations Engineer, PubNub
BuildJul 22, 2019

Making Chatbots Talk with IBM Watson Text-to-Speech

How to build a chatbot application that analyzes a stream of text, and uses Watson text-to-speech to speak based on customized thresholds.

Michael Carroll
Michael Carroll
Real-time charts highcharts pubnub
BuildJul 3, 2019

Build a Real-time Voting or Polling App using Highcharts

Create an interactive, live-updating voting and polling app with a wide variety of chart options – spline, pie, column, bar and more.

Chandler Mayo
Chandler Mayo
Solution Engineer, PubNub